| The Denver School of the Arts Vocal Music Department will present its 1st Annual Madrigal Dinner on Friday and Saturday, Nov. 7 – 8 at 6 p.m. in the commons at the school. Tickets are $25 and include dinner and entertainment.
Come feast on cheddar cheese spread, leg of chicken, sausages, shredded pork on rolls, baked potato bathed in beef burgundy sauce, corn cobblets, a parade of vegetables (pickled and otherwise), desserts of the British Isles, mulled cider and hot tea. Entertainment will be provided by two of DSA's vocal music ensembles, 4 Squared and Bellissima.
Freshman and Sophomore level girls are singers in Bellissima (Italian word meaning "the most beautiful”). This group is comprised of approximately twenty singers and performs three- and four-part choral music. The choir sings advanced repertoire for women. 4 Squared is a sixteen-voice group which performs a demanding eclectic repertoire. They frequently perform at conventions, schools, special events and festivals throughout the Metro Denver area. This group is open by audition only to all high school students at DSA.
